Staying productive while juggling coding and coffee can be quite the challenge, especially when the coding demands your full attention and caffeine becomes your lifeline. To navigate this balance effectively, it’s essential to establish a structured routine that incorporates both activities seamlessly. Consider using the Pomodoro Technique: work for 25 minutes on your coding tasks, followed by a 5-minute break to enjoy a cup of coffee. This method not only enhances concentration but also prevents burnout, allowing you to fuel your body and brain during those long coding sessions.
Additionally, creating a dedicated workspace can significantly enhance your productivity. Ensure that your coding area is free from distractions, while also having your coffee maker within reach to avoid unnecessary interruptions. It's important to optimize your environment to keep the flow going. Furthermore, pair your coding sessions with your favorite coffee blend or explore new flavors to keep things exciting and to stimulate your senses. By intertwining your love for coding with coffee, you can maintain focus and boost your creativity, ensuring each session is as productive as possible.
As a web developer, it’s easy to fall into a few common traps that can compromise the quality of your projects. One of the most frequent mistakes is neglecting responsive design. In today's mobile-first world, ensuring that your website looks good and functions well across various devices is crucial. Developers often underestimate the importance of adaptability, resulting in a frustrating user experience. Additionally, not utilizing version control can lead to significant headaches. Without a proper versioning system like Git, tracking changes and collaborating with other developers becomes a daunting task. Over time, this oversight can yield chaos in your codebase.
Another frequent misstep is overlooking browser compatibility. Many developers create websites that function perfectly in one browser while failing miserably in another. It’s essential to test your web applications across multiple platforms to ensure a consistent experience for all users. Furthermore, neglecting SEO best practices can severely hinder your website's visibility. Failing to optimize meta tags, using incorrect heading structures, or not implementing schema markup can all contribute to poor search engine rankings. To avoid these pitfalls, regularly review your coding practices and stay updated with industry standards.
